With 12 days to the start of another school year, needy children in the Eastern Division now have their school needs met with the timely assistance from Save the Children Fiji.

Today the organisation’s CEO Chandra Shekar gave out education assistance kits to students at the primary and school levels.

These kits contain exercise books, math work books, note books, mathematical sets, erasers and other supplies.

Save the Children will continue distributing among needy children in the West and North from tomorrow.

It is also expected that by tomorrow over 15,000 children in Fiji will receive these free education kits.

According to Shekar $18,000 in total was spent on these education assistance kits.
